Wednesday, March 25, 2009

Images from Discovery's Station Fly Around

Cameras from aboard the international space station recorded these images of Discovery between 4:35 and 4:50 pm ET today, as the pair flew 225 miles above the Gulf of Mexico. Discovery later flew high over a cloudy Houston, Texas - home of the Johnson Space Center - at 4:52 pm [first image above].

"NASA's 100 Billion dollar picture", is what Mission Control jokingly called the image above late today, following yesterday's President Obama call to the crews and what one senator priced the space station at after construction.

High over the Pacific Ocean, Discovery's camera captures the top of the station from 610 feet out at 4:30 pm ET.

